大体上来讲,Linux分为两个生态体系,红帽和debian。商业版本以Redhat为代表,开源社区版本则以debian为代表。
这里我们需要使用Debian的系统,展示的系统为Ubuntu
1、sl 命令
你会看到一辆火车从屏幕右边开往左边……
当然我们需要先安装软件包:
sudo apt-get install sl
然后运行sl即可看到效果
2、fortune
输出一句话,有笑话,名言什么的 (还有唐诗宋词)。
软件包安装:
sudo apt-get install fortune
fortune 这些都是英文的,如果你想看中国的唐诗三百首,则需要再安装:
sudo apt-get install fortune-zh
执行fortune
3、cowsay
用ASCII字符打印牛、羊等动物。
也是需要先安装软件包:
sudo apt-get install cowsay
cowsay “xxxx”
还有一种骚操作是 cowsay -l 查看其它动物的名字,然后 -f 跟上动物名cowsay -f tux “xxx” 企鹅+xxx
4、cmatrix
这个就很酷,有《黑客帝国》那种矩阵风格的动画效果。
先安装软件包:
sudo apt-get install cmatrix
运行cmatrix命令即可:
5、figlet 、toilet
艺术字生成器,由 ASCII 字符组成,把文本显示成标题栏。
先安装软件包:
sudo apt-get install figlet
sudo apt-get install toilet
运行:figlet xxxx
Toilet xxxx
toilet 还可以添加颜色toilet -f mono12 -F xxxx
6、 oneko
桌面上出现一只喵星人,跟着你的鼠标跑,你不动了它就睡觉。
软件包安装:
sudo apt-get install oneko
直接oneko命令运行
要关掉这个小家伙,直接 ctrl + c 即可。
7、screenfetch
这个命令可以用来显示系统、主题信息。
软件包安装:
sudo apt install screenfetch
直接运行screenfetch命令即可:
8、linux_logo
这个命令可以用来显示 linux 版本 logo 图片及系统信息。
安装软件包:
sudo apt install linuxlogo
直接运行linux_logo命令即可
我们可以查看内置的 logo 列表:linux_logo -f -L list
接下来我们开始利用命令在终端循环打印 logo:
for i in {1..30};do linux_logo -f -L $i;sleep 2;done
9、boxes
这个命令可以实现在输入的文本或者代码周围框上各种 ASCII 艺术画,非常有趣!
首先安装软件包:
sudo apt-get install boxes
现在我把一段文字不加任何效果输出是这样的:echo “什么”| boxes
现在加上小猫的图案:echo “什么”| boxes -d cat
亦或者小狗:echo “什么”| boxes -d dog
小老鼠:echo “什么”| boxes -d mouse
10、hollywood
高大上仪表盘,假装自己日理万机,宵衣旰食。听起来是不是很不错。Dustin Kirkland 利用一个长途飞行的时间,编写了这个炫酷、有趣但也没什么实际作用的软件。 在其它 Linux 发行版中,可以通过以下命令安装。
sudo apt-add-repository ppa:hollywood/ppa
sudo apt-get install hollywood
sudo apt-get install byobu
然后通过hollywood这个命令即可欣赏到一个炫酷的界面
更多的效果就不展示了,等待着你们去发现~